Instructions for Use:

  1. Mounting:

    • Ensure the device is mounted on a suitable heatsink to manage the thermal load, especially when operating at high current levels.
    • Use thermal grease or a thermal pad between the device and the heatsink to improve heat transfer.
  2. Electrical Connections:

    • Connect the forward voltage (VF) across the device terminals with the correct polarity.
    • Do not exceed the maximum forward current (IF) or pulse current (IF(P)) ratings to avoid damage.
    • Ensure that the reverse voltage (VR) does not exceed the maximum rating to prevent breakdown.
  3. Thermal Management:

    • Monitor the junction temperature (TJ) to ensure it remains within the specified range. Exceeding the maximum junction temperature can lead to device failure.
    • If operating in environments with high ambient temperatures, consider additional cooling measures such as forced air cooling.
  4. Storage:

    • Store the device in a dry environment within the storage temperature range (TSTG) to prevent damage from moisture or extreme temperatures.
  5. Handling:

    • Handle the device with care to avoid mechanical stress or damage to the leads.
    • Use appropriate ESD protection when handling to prevent electrostatic discharge damage.
  6. Testing:

    • Before installation, test the device using a low current to verify its functionality and ensure it meets the specified parameters.
    • Regularly inspect the device for signs of wear or damage during operation and maintenance.
